CHEROKEE ALBUM OF THE WEEK - STATION TO STATION

Station to Station was Bowie’s 10th studio album and the title track is solidified as the longest studio recording of his career (over 10 minutes!) During the production of this masterpiece, Cherokee Studios was his headquarters. We recorded it around Sept/Nov 1975 and by 1976, it was a certified gold record!

Bowie has discussed being heavily addicted and influenced by co***ne during this era. Once, when asked about the recording experience, Bowie could only comment, “I know it was recorded in LA because I read it was!”

Station to Station is also significant because it introduced a new persona for Bowie: the Thin White Duke. This character was charming on the outside but soulless and malevolent deep down. He preformed as the Duke during his Isolar tour in 1976, and retired him promptly after.

TBT

Did you know that every Beatle independently recorded at Cherokee at some point? Ringo did 2 albums at the studio with Bruce & Dee Robb. Here is Ringo at the studio in 1981.

Behind the scenes of filming “On the Record” about the legendary Steve Cropper at Cherokee Studios with music legends.

Interview with Steve Lukather, he is an iconic American guitarist, singer, and songwriter, best known as a founding member of the Grammy-winning rock band Toto. With his masterful guitar work and versatile musicianship, Lukather has contributed to countless hits, including “Rosanna,” “Africa,” and “Hold the Line.” Beyond Toto, he is one of the most sought-after session musicians in the industry, having played on over 1,500 albums with artists ranging from Michael Jackson to Paul McCartney. Lukather’s impact on rock music is profound, making him a true legend in the world of guitar.

Behind the scenes of filming “On the Record” about the legendary Steve Cropper at Cherokee Studios with music legends.

Kenny Aronoff is a highly acclaimed American drummer known for his powerful, precise playing style and versatility across various musical genres. He gained prominence as the drummer for John Mellencamp, contributing to many of his hits like “Jack and Diane” and “Hurts So Good.” Over his extensive career, Aronoff has played with a wide range of artists, including Bob Dylan, The Rolling Stones, Bruce Springsteen, and Paul McCartney. His dynamic drumming has made him one of the most sought-after session and touring drummers in the music industry.
